Retext
Retext is a macOS text expander that simplifies repetitive typing by using AI-driven shortcuts. Unlike traditional expanders, Retext doesn’t require memorizing shortcuts; it intelligently suggests them across any app or browser. Key features include a native macOS design, universal compatibility, and reliable functionality, ensuring it’s always available. By organizing snippets intuitively, Retext boosts productivity, providing users with a seamless typing experience. Inbox Zapper
Inbox Zapper is a gmail unsubscribe tool that allows you to unsubscribe from emails with 1 click. A gmail unsubscribe tool that actually works - mass delete and unsubscribe from unwanted emails instantly. Inbox Zapper scans your inbox for email lists and unwanted emails, letting you unsubscribe from thousands of junk emails and mass delete emails in just a click. Using our Chrome extension or web app, you connect your gmail account, and view a filtered list of all your subscriptions. You can then decide to either keep and mark them safe, or unsubscribe. You can also mass delete all previous emails from that sender. We use a new method that is guaranteed to block new emails, unlike what traditional email blockers do which is often unreliable and doesn't work.
